What's interesting is the design of the Kop. The current Kop roof slopes down, so much in fact, that you only see just above the goal of the Annie Road end if you're at the back. The new roof curves over the Kop. I'm wondering if this has been designed with the acoustics of the stadium taken into consideration thus further emphasising the Kop choir. That's really clever if that's the case.
